Here's the Lowdown: Tourist or Time Traveler?

  • Catching a Flick: If you're hankering for a classic movie experience under the ornate Los Angeles Theatre ceiling, then you're in luck! The theatre regularly screens films, so snag your tickets and get ready for a night of popcorn-munching and cinematic magic.

  • Living Your Best Tour Guide Life: For those who crave a deeper dive, the Los Angeles Theatre sometimes offers tours. Imagine strolling through the opulent halls, whispering secrets to the velvet curtains, and picturing A-listers gracing the very spot you're standing on. Be sure to check their website for upcoming tours – they might sell out faster than you can say "lights, camera, action!"

Word to the Wise: Don't just show up expecting a red-carpet welcome. These tours are like gold bullion – rare and valuable.

Alas, Not Every Day is Opening Night:

  • Special Events Only: Sometimes, the Los Angeles Theatre transforms into a venue for galas, premieres, and events that would make your Instagram followers jealous. Unless you're on the guest list, you might be stuck admiring the building from afar.
